Output d3425ec8eafe4d276ff36bc1221bc2d9626fcaa70315fd7af7ace505cb521056:1

value
1438511811
script pubkey
OP_0 OP_PUSHBYTES_20 03c3d4bb9dda5c5b8bcbb910e26adb853fe39c39
address
bc1qq0pafwuamfw9hz7thygwy6kms5l788pezxg8dk
transaction
d3425ec8eafe4d276ff36bc1221bc2d9626fcaa70315fd7af7ace505cb521056
spent
true